No policy regarding free use of facilities By BOB BRUTON Barrie Examiner March 8 2011 Barrie's community grants program has gone from hero to zero. City councillors decided Monday to do away with the $100,000 fund, which is for community groups and organizations looking for money for their events and programs. "We are looking at a 5.4% tax increase (this year)," said Coun. John Brassard. "We have to look after our own house. That $100,000 can go a long way. "We just can't give money away." Coun. Michael Prowse, who is also chairman of the city finance committee, made a similar argument.
